A large late hellenistic carnelian intaglio. Cornucopia.

2nd century B.C.

14 x 17 x 3,5 mm

This beautiful and well detailed cornucopia with ribbons is inspired by ptolemaic coins issues (see: Ptolemaic Kings of Egypt, Arsinoe II Philadelphos or Ptolemy III Evergetes and posthumus issues, mint of Alexandria). Emblema of good luck and abundance, elegantly composed. Use of globular elements. Slight wear marks. Attractive color of the stone.
